Engenharia reversa do WordPress: como replicar um site WordPress
Publicados: 2018-05-24Este site parece tão bom. Eu gostaria de ter um site assim.
Isso soa familiar?
Esse é o pensamento de quase todos os blogueiros quando veem um site, exibindo uma interface de usuário legal, cores, fontes etc.
Já me peguei na mesma situação várias vezes e sabia que algo precisava ser feito. Então, fui em frente e fiz minha pesquisa.
Mais especificamente, encontrei ferramentas que podem decodificar um site, revelando todos os segredos subjacentes que o alimentam.
Neste post, estou compartilhando minha estratégia de engenharia reversa do WordPress e uma lista de ferramentas que você pode usar para replicar qualquer site WordPress.
Mas Shafi, por que WordPress? Você pode perguntar.
A razão é bem simples. O WordPress é um dos sistemas de gerenciamento de conteúdo mais populares e alimenta 28,6% de todos os sites na internet.
Surpreendentemente, todos os dias mais 50.000 sites WordPress são lançados ( fonte ) e sites populares como TechCrunch, Disney, Sony, etc.
Espero que isso responda sua pergunta.
[click_to_tweet tweet=”Todos os dias 50.000 blogs WordPress são lançados e torna-se importante ter um ótimo design e funcionalidade. Aqui estão 5 passos para copiar qualquer blog WordPress. #WordPress #OceanWP #WordPressFacts” quote=”Você sabia que todos os dias 50.000 novos blogs WordPress são lançados. #WordPressFacts”]
Pronto para rolar? Vamos começar.
Etapa 0: verificar se o site está usando o WordPress
Você viu isso chegando, não é?
Claro, a primeira coisa que precisamos fazer é verificar se nosso site favorito está usando o WordPress. Se não for, não faz sentido seguir essa estratégia e você continuará coçando a cabeça nas etapas posteriores.
Para verificar qual sistema de gerenciamento de conteúdo (CMS) alimenta um site, usaremos o WhatCMS.org – uma ferramenta online gratuita.
O uso da ferramenta é simples, copie o site a ser testado, insira-o na caixa do site fornecida e pressione Enter.

A ferramenta executará conjuntos de algoritmos e fornecerá um resultado mostrando qual CMS está sendo usado pelo site.
Passo 1: Copiando o desenho
O próximo passo óbvio é verificar qual tema WordPress está sendo usado pelo site em questão. Só para você saber, existem pelo menos dez mil diferentes temas WordPress gratuitos e premium disponíveis para uso, o que oferece aos proprietários de sites opções suficientes.
Além disso, muitos proprietários de sites usam um tema desenvolvido personalizado que pode ser uma versão personalizada de uma estrutura ou um tema codificado do zero.
Para verificar qual tema do WordPress está sendo usado, você pode usar WPThemeDetector.com – outra ferramenta gratuita.
A ferramenta é avançada e detecta facilmente o tema ou a estrutura subjacente (mesmo que esteja oculta), o que não é possível com outras ferramentas semelhantes, como WhatWPThemeIsThat.com.

Além de detectar o tema, a ferramenta também dará mais informações sobre o desenvolvedor, quantos outros sites o utilizam e links oficiais.
O que fazer se o site estiver usando um tema personalizado?
Conforme discutido anteriormente, é muito possível que alguns sites possam estar usando um tema personalizado desenvolvido do zero. Nesses casos, a ferramenta acima não será de muita ajuda.
Mas não perca as esperanças, você pode pregar o mesmo design de site usando uma combinação de tema OceanWP e construtores de páginas como o Elementor.
O OceanWP é facilmente o tema mais personalizável que você encontraria e com um construtor de páginas, tão intuitivo e fácil de usar quanto o Elementor, oferece todo o poder em suas mãos.
Você pode literalmente arrastar e soltar componentes pré-fabricados, ajustar o tamanho/cor, adicionar alguns ajustes de CSS e obter um design quase semelhante.
Passo 2: Obtenha as funcionalidades certas!
Ok, então você tem os designs certos e seu site WordPress recém-criado parece semelhante. Mas, não é nada sem funcionalidades semelhantes ou devo dizer plugins.
Um site WordPress médio é alimentado por pelo menos 10 plugins diferentes, cada um fornecendo uma funcionalidade única.
Seu site ideal também está usando vários plugins para ter essa funcionalidade elegante e experiência do usuário. Além disso, é uma boa ideia obter informações de plugins, pois eles teriam tentado vários plugins antes de se decidir por aquele específico.
Embora seja difícil obter uma lista exata de plugins sendo usados (muitos desenvolvedores ocultam o nome e as informações), o scanwp.net pode recuperar as informações com eficiência.


Ele também encontra o link oficial para plugins disponíveis no repositório WordPress e se é gratuito ou não.
Passo 3: Não se esqueça da experiência de leitura
Conforme explicado aqui , a fonte usada pode realmente afetar a forma como as respostas individuais a um conteúdo.
No experimento acima, o primeiro grupo de pessoas (com fonte de fácil leitura) estimou que a tarefa levaria 8,2 minutos para ser concluída. Considerando que, o segundo grupo (com fonte difícil de ler) estimou impressionantes 15,1 minutos.

Isso é uma diferença enorme e faz todo o sentido. Se você achar difícil ler a instrução, sua mente irá processá-la mais lentamente e, portanto, um tempo de estimativa alto. Definitivamente, o que você quer para o seu blog.
Se você deseja uma experiência de leitura semelhante, tente usar a mesma fonte usada por esse site. Você pode detectar facilmente qual fonte um site está usando a extensão WhatFont Chrome .
Instale a extensão, visite o site (de preferência uma página de artigo), clique no botão de extensão WhatFont (disponível no canto superior direito da tela) e passe o mouse sobre o texto.

Você não apenas obtém a fonte exata, mas também o tamanho da fonte, estilo, peso e um link para a fonte da web do Google para fazer o download.
Passo 4: Alguém disse cor?
Novamente, as cores são algo que se relaciona com a psicologia humana e os especialistas sugerem usar uma paleta de cores ideal com base no nicho do site.
De acordo com a Kissmetrics , as cores afetam o comportamento de compra e, com base no tipo de público, você deve escolher um esquema de cores adequado.

Embora você possa dar uma olhada e obter o esquema de cores usado pelo seu site favorito, faz mais sentido obter o tom de cor exato e o código hexadecimal.
ColorCombos.com tem uma ferramenta online que pode pegar as paletas de cores usadas por uma página web. Você só precisa inserir o URL da página e pressionar enter.
Em poucos segundos, você obterá uma lista de todas as paletas de cores usadas com frequência no site com código hexadecimal e uma opção para baixar o esquema de cores.
Etapa 5: velocidade do site
Estou bastante confiante de que a primeira boa impressão que você teve sobre o site foi por causa da velocidade de carregamento. Não importa quão bom seja o design ou a interface do usuário, se ele carregar em 3-4 segundos ou mais, você terá fechado a guia e nunca mais retornará.
A hospedagem na Web é uma das principais razões por trás de um bom tempo de carregamento e você provavelmente pode se perguntar qual hospedagem está sendo usada para alimentar este site. Se você não conseguir obter a resposta navegando no site (na maioria dos casos, estará escrito no rodapé), você pode usar a ferramenta do HostAdvice.com para obter o provedor de hospedagem.
Ao contrário de outras ferramentas que usam apenas o Nameserver para detectar o host da Web, essa ferramenta pode revelar o host oculto em caso de uso da CDN.
Sem essa ferramenta, eu nunca saberia que o OceanWP.org está hospedado no Google Cloud Platform com CloudFlare CDN (isso explica o tempo de carregamento super rápido)

Além disso, você pode ver os planos de hospedagem e as avaliações dos usuários na mesma página.
Conclusão
Ai está!
Agora você é um assassino secreto que pode rapidamente fazer engenharia reversa de um site WordPress e replicá-lo desde o design até as funcionalidades do site.
Se houver qualquer outra coisa que você queira em seu site, mas não conseguiu encontrar como isso é feito, considere entrar em contato diretamente com o proprietário do site. Na maioria dos casos, eles o guiarão em direção à fonte da funcionalidade ou ao desenvolvedor que a escreveu.
Você tem alguma ferramenta secreta que usa para replicar um site WordPress? Eu adoraria ouvir sobre isso. Deixe um comentário e podemos discutir isso. Certifique-se de compartilhar este artigo com seus amigos amantes do WordPress que podem achar útil.